干旱胁迫下大豆品种抗旱性评价与筛选

摘    要:选用43个大豆品种,利用盆栽干旱胁迫的方法,对叶片萎蔫度、抗旱系数、抗旱指数和隶属函数等指标进行综合评定,筛选抗旱型大豆品种。结果表明:利用上述4种方法筛选出3个高抗旱型品种分别为PI47938、通州豆、中作92-51,8个中抗旱型大豆品种分别为中黄1号、中黄10号、中作96-2、早熟18、科丰6号、中作305、中作96-952和科丰14;上述品种可以作为抗旱品种选育的亲本材料。

Identification and Selection of Soybean Drought-resistant Variety on the Drought Intimidation

Abstract:43 soybean varieties were identified by the degree of betel,the drought-resistant coefficient,the drought-resistant exponential and their membership functions to select the drought-resistant variety in water threatening flowerpot.The results were shown that PI47938、Tongzhou Soybean and Zhongzuo 92-5 were the high drought-resistant varieties and Zhonghuang 1,Zhonghuang 10,Zhongzuo96-2,Zaoshu 18,Kefeng 6,Zhongzuo 305、Zhongzuo 96-952 and Kefeng14 were the middling drought-resistant varieties.Above varieties could be used as the drought-resistant resource in breeding program.
